Royal Purple Gear Lube Oil
GM recommends 80w, 80W90 GL5 gear lube, + GM additive #1052271 for limited slip differentials for my KITT
I want to use Royal Purple 75w90 Gear lube to my rear end, will it screw up my rear end? Should I add the additive or not? or use something else?

Re: Royal Purple Gear Lube Oil
Hi:
It will not hurt the rear End. Just stay with the same weight that GM Recommends. I
I had used the Royal Purple Gear oil before in my 85 Trans Am with Australian 9 Bolt Rear End, it was good. I did not add any other additives. I have since switched to Amsoil Gear Oil for the Rear End.
I have been using Amsoil Syntheic Oils in the engine and their products seem to work very well my cars. Just a personal thing I guess.
